Political Games on Lajes Summit. To illustrate an article on the book “A Cimeira das Lajes - Portugal e a Guerra do Iraque” by Bernardo Pires de Lima, published on Diário de Notícias, QI Cultural Supplement on 09.03.13.
The article refers to the political manipulation that lead to the Lajes (Azores) Summit to have the UK approval on the Irqi war and Spain’s manipulation on the Summit’s location to have some projection on it.
My deadline was shorter than usual and the article was very complex. I chose to draw in a cartoonish style because was the best way to illustrate the article with a little sense of humor. The main characters in that piece were George W. Bush, representing the USA and José Maria Aznar, representing Spain, so I focused on them both manipulating the UK and Portugal, respectively.
I love political Cartoon, so this particular piece was very sweet on me! Hope you guys like it as much as I enjoyed working on it!
This illustrates Andrew Hacker’s article for QI about Nate Silver’s book “The Signal and the Noise”. It was quite a challenge as the concept was all about his method of prevision that allowed him forecast with accuracy the last USA’s presidential election results. In the book he talks about two types of people, the Fox that has several small ideas and the hedgehog that has only one big idea. He also compares some methods of prevision to Tarot because they disregard the human factor so they are most fallible… That’s how I came up with this illustration.
I decided to use the Fox and the Hedgehog as main characters playing chess that is a strategy game opposed to a Tarot Card played by the Hedgehog that is his random big idea. I chose “Death” for two reasons, the meaning of this card is change and also QI’s main theme was Death too.
This time I went totally analogue and used pencil and colored pencil to transmit the idea of traditional fable which I thought was the most appropriate approach to this article.
It was published on Diário de Notícias Saturday cultural supplement QI on 23.02.2013. Hope you guys enjoy it as much as I enjoyed illustrating it! Stay tuned!
